Top 150 Bank and Thrift Holding Companies by U.S. Banking Assets*

June 30, 2001 data; dollars in thousands
Published November 15, 2001

Rank 

Company

June 2001assets 

Dec. 2000 assets 

1 J.P. Morgan Chase & Co. New York $661,308,936 $602,902,049
2 Bank of America Corp. Charlotte, N.C. 595,225,185 609,917,933
3 Citigroup Inc. New York 492,099,552 481,337,289
4 Wachovia Corp. Charlotte, N.C. 305,390,779 314,091,192
5 Bank One Corp. Chicago 304,076,676 306,987,164
6 Wells Fargo & Co. San Francisco 283,329,661 284,210,610
7 Washington Mutual Inc. Seattle 224,289,910 209,114,509
8 FleetBoston Financial Corp. Boston 196,701,595 212,537,918
9 U.S. Bancorp Milwaukee 165,698,516 163,492,886
10 National City Corp. Cleveland 103,616,977 95,728,465
11 SunTrust Banks Inc. Atlanta 98,222,236 99,647,470
12 KeyCorp Cleveland 83,215,957 83,874,644
13 HSBC Holdings PLC London 82,822,623 80,121,433
14 Bank of New York Co. Inc. New York 75,162,472 75,289,222
15 Fifth Third Bancorp Cincinnati 72,722,270 72,355,498
16 BB&T Corp. Winston-Salem, N.C. 67,170,367 64,700,078
17 ABN Amro Amsterdam 66,816,797 64,279,656
18 State Street Corp. Boston 65,690,723 64,643,911
19 PNC Financial Services Group Pittsburgh 65,532,087 65,737,037
20 Golden State Bancorp Inc. San Francisco, Calif. 61,250,773 60,462,963

*Banking assets are defined as assets reported to the FDIC through their U.S. bank and S&L subsidiaries and can differ from assets reported at the holding company level. Assets for both midyear 2001 and yearend 2000 restated in some cases to reflect mergers or other ownership changes by companies or their predecessors through Nov. 12, 2001.
